所以我对软件很陌生。我想弄清楚如何使用Cucumber BDD和python脚本来自动测试android .apk?我对intellij IDE有点熟悉,所以我想用它。我以前能够使用cucumber-JVM和appium与maven构建工具建立一个测试框架,主要是因为G BoxT在youtube上的教程。我知道这个问题有点模糊,但也许有人可以指出我正确的方向,我需要将这个框架放在一起的工具是什么?我已经做了很多阅读,但似乎无法理解它将如何组合在一起。我需要什么依赖?
答案 0 :(得分:0)
听起来很像你想要使用与我的配置类似的东西。虽然,我不确定你在使用Pycharm时会想要使用IntelliJ。
那就是说,有了Pycharm,我有了Behave插件this is a good guide. 您必须拥有Pycharm的专业版本,但我已经能够使用任何文本编辑器编写Gherkin并使用.feature扩展名命名BDD功能文件。只要特征文件与脚本位于同一目录中,它就应该相对简单。
我的设置:
PyCharm Pro使用Behave插件和appium的python绑定。 Appium 1.6.3。 Android Studio或您可以使用真实设备,只安装Android SDK。
确实如此。
就培训而言,您可能希望看看Udemy,但YouTube上有相当多的资源,但我在Udemy上学到了很多。
Lotsa Luck!